Jquery验证插件检查至少有1个字母和1个数字

Jquery验证插件检查至少有1个字母和1个数字,jquery,regex,jquery-validate,Jquery,Regex,Jquery Validate,我承认,说到正则表达式,我是个十足的傻瓜。我正在尝试为jquery验证插件编写一个自定义验证方法。我试图检查输入中是否至少有一个数字和一个字母 这是我现在想到的,但它不起作用。非常感谢您的帮助 jQuery.validator.addMethod("ContainsAtLeastOneDigit", function (value) { return /^[a-z]+[0-9]/i.test(value); }, 'Your input must contain at lea

我承认,说到正则表达式,我是个十足的傻瓜。我正在尝试为jquery验证插件编写一个自定义验证方法。我试图检查输入中是否至少有一个数字和一个字母

这是我现在想到的,但它不起作用。非常感谢您的帮助

jQuery.validator.addMethod("ContainsAtLeastOneDigit", function (value) { 
        return /^[a-z]+[0-9]/i.test(value); 
}, 'Your input must contain at least 1 letter and 1 number');

谢谢。

将文本与至少1个字母和1个数字匹配的JavaScript正则表达式:

/[a-z].[0-9]|[0-9].[a-z]/i
它检查文本是否包含字母
[a-z]
和数字
[0-9]
,其他字符
*
可选介于两者之间,或
数字和字母,其他字符可选介于两者之间


一个JavaScript正则表达式,用于匹配至少1个字母和1个数字的文本:

/[a-z].[0-9]|[0-9].[a-z]/i
它检查文本是否包含字母
[a-z]
和数字
[0-9]
,其他字符
*
可选介于两者之间,或
数字和字母,其他字符可选介于两者之间


太棒了。这就像做梦一样。非常感谢。只要斯塔克允许,我就接受你的回答。再次感谢,太棒了。这就像做梦一样。非常感谢。只要斯塔克允许,我就接受你的回答。再次感谢。如果您正在对密码进行此验证以使其更安全,则最好使用更直接地检查密码的安全性。像
发布到
部门这样的短语比
密码1
更安全,尽管它没有通过您的验证。谢谢您的提示。这是一个有用的链接。谢天谢地,在这种情况下,它只是一个文本字段,而不是密码。如果您对密码进行验证以使其更安全,那么最好使用更直接地检查密码的安全性。像
发布到
部门这样的短语比
密码1
更安全,尽管它没有通过您的验证。谢谢您的提示。这是一个有用的链接。谢天谢地,在这种情况下,它只是一个文本字段,而不是密码。